NAD⁺ (Nicotinamide Adenine Dinucleotide) 500 mg is a scientifically recognized coenzyme widely utilized in biochemical and metabolic laboratory research. As a central component in cellular energy production and redox reactions, NAD⁺ is essential for studying mitochondrial pathways, enzyme activity, and cellular metabolic processes in controlled research environments across the United States.

Key Research Properties of NAD⁺
Essential Coenzyme in Cellular Energy Studies
NAD⁺ is extensively researched for its role in:
-
Electron transport chain mechanisms
-
ATP production pathways
-
Oxidation-reduction reactions
-
Enzyme cofactor activity
-
Cellular signaling and metabolic regulation
Its involvement in fundamental biological systems makes it a frequently referenced molecule in molecular biology and biochemical studies.
